East Jakarta Has Prepared Disaster Mitigation Infrastructure

East Jakarta Social Sub-agency has prepared a number of facilities and infrastructure for disaster mitigation.

Social Protection and Poor Prevention Division Head Abdul Salam said his party was always ready to handle disasters, like floods, fires or other disasters.

For the infrastructures and infrastructure that had been prepared were including 200 personnel of emergency response unit (Tagana), 12 personnel of Social Disaster Preparedness (KSB), 5 units of evacuation tents with a capacity of 20-40 people, food/beverage logistics and clothing for people affected by the floods.

"We prepare them for disaster mitigation and post-disaster," he expressed, Wednesday (10/7).

There were also other preparations, including 1 unit of mobile public kitchen vehicle, 2 operational vehicles, 3 service cars, 1 unit of motorboat made from fiber, 20 units of life vests and 3 round buoys, as well as 1 public kitchen on standby at the East Jakarta Social Sub-agency Office, Jalan H. Naman Pondok Kelapa, Duren Sawit.

"So, residents do not need to worry as we have prepared all disaster management needs," he stated.
